It's Time to Enter the Firefox Labs

Mozilla is rolling out Firefox Labs as a new way to try experimental features in the Firefox web browser. There are four options right now, including a link preview mode and new customizations for the New Tab page. You can already test many of the features in development for Firefox through config settings, Firefox Beta, or Firefox Nightly. However, the config settings are mostly just intended for development and debugging purposes—changing some of them can cause data loss or performance issues....

Samsung SmartThings Is The First Functional Matter Smart Home Hub

The Matter smart home standard has just received a major boost. Samsung is applying the standard to its SmartThings home hubs – and you may already own one of the devices the South Korean company is updating. Following the update, the applicable SmartThing’s hubs are capable of controlling all Matter certified devices. Both second and-third generation hubs will get the update, so even if you have a slightly older home assistant you’ll still be “Matter ready....
